Output e88df150c0e3e62198f8a101c232ce500ab07c4dd172bc9e25a0745238c990f4:33

value
4326659
script pubkey
OP_0 OP_PUSHBYTES_20 d39646e78644923f0b5bee9ae4a2a976b2bae2c7
address
bc1q6wtydeuxgjfr7z6ma6dwfg4fw6et4ck8lzp5u4
transaction
e88df150c0e3e62198f8a101c232ce500ab07c4dd172bc9e25a0745238c990f4